Free/ Political Speech
While you do NOT have the right to proselytize, disparage student beliefs, or use school time or resources to advance political or religious causes, you do have the right to speak freely and engage in political advocacy in your off duty hours. You are also empowered to wear political buttons and attire during the school day, and at parent community events. We recommend that our members know their rights about political advocacy, and use them judiciously and appropriately
